在当今数字经济发展的浪潮中,区块链技术正日益渗透到各行各业。无论是金融、物流还是供应链管理,区块链都凭借其透明性和去中心化的特点,受到广泛关注。然而,随着区块链网络的复杂性提升,如何准确、有效地查看区块链信息的正常性,便成为用户、开发者以及企业的一大挑战。在本篇文章中,我们将从多个角度详细探讨如何查看区块链信息是否正常,并对可能遇到的问题作出深入解析。
在探讨如何查看区块链信息是否正常之前,我们首先需要理解区块链的基本结构。区块链是一种分布式的数据库技术,由一系列按时间顺序链接的区块组成。每个区块包含一组交易记录和一个指向前一个区块的哈希(hash)值。
除了基本的交易数据,区块链还包含其他关键信息,如时间戳、创建者的数字签名等。这些组成部分确保了数据的不可篡改性和可追溯性。
一旦区块被添加到区块链上,就无法再进行修改,这对于信息的真实性显得尤为重要。因此,查看区块链信息是否正常,首先应从区块和交易的详细信息入手,确保每一项数据都符合预期。
区块链浏览器是一种常见且有效的工具,用于查询和验证区块链上的信息。它提供了一个用户友好的界面,用户可以输入交易哈希、区块号或钱包地址,即可检索相关信息。
例如,以比特币为例,用户可以通过访问像 Blockchain.info、Blockcypher 等区块链浏览器,轻松查找到交易的状态、所在区块的高度以及确认次数等信息。这些都是判断区块链信息是否正常的关键指标。
当查询到某笔交易时,请关注以下几点:
在许多区块链网络中,节点是确保网络正常运行的基础。节点的健康状态直接影响整个区块链的运作。如果节点出现宕机、失效或与其他节点失去连接,可能导致信息显示不正常。
要检查节点的健康状况,可以通过以下几种方式:
不同的区块链采用不同的共识机制,如证明工作量(PoW)、权益证明(PoS)等。这些机制确保网络中的交易得到验证和添加。因此,了解所用区块链的共识机制,有助于判断网络是否正常运行。例如,当网络的矿工数量大幅下降时,PoW 区块链的交易确认速度可能会变慢。
除了机制本身的了解外,观察机制期间的表现变化也同样重要。例如,在高峰时段,交易确认时间可能会延迟,如果长时间没有交易被确认,则有可能是网络出现了拥堵或其他问题。
总结来说,通过监测共识机制下的交易速度、网络参与度及其稳定性,可以获取对区块链信息正常性的更深入理解。
对于某个区块链项目而言,社区的反馈往往可以提供一种“共识”的感觉。通过关注项目的官方社交媒体、论坛及邮件列表,能够及时获取社区成员对区块链运行状态的看法。例如,如果大家普遍反馈某笔交易长期没有确认,或者网络状态不佳,那很可能实际上网络存在问题。
此外,可以使用一些数据监控平台,如 Dune Analytics 或者 Glassnode,这些工具和服务提供的数据可实时反映网络的健康状态,像交易量、活跃地址数、矿工活动等,均能作为判断区块链信息正常与否的重要参考。
在区块链网络中,交易被确认是指交易被矿工成功计算进一个新的区块并且加入到区块链中。确认的多少次通常是衡量交易安全的标准。对于比特币等网络,如果你希望某个交易获得较高的确认保障,一般建议等待至少6次确认,而对于小额交易,1-3次确认也许就足够了。
要确认交易是否已经被区块链确认,您可以使用区块链浏览器,如 BlockExplorer。输入您所关注的交易哈希,查看该交易的当前状态和确认次数。如果确认次数为零,说明交易还没有被任何矿工处理,可能需要进一步的关注。
值得注意的是,交易的确认时间还受网络繁忙程度影响。当网络交易量大时,交易处理时间可能会延长,从而影响确认次数。因此,用户的耐心和对网络状况的实时了解显得尤为重要。
针对未确认的交易,首先要了解未确认的原因,可能是网络拥堵导致交易未处理,或者是交易费设置得过低导致矿工不愿意确认此交易。如果交易材料较多,用户可以选择等待,直到网络恢复正常。
对于过低的交易费用,可以尝试使用交易促销功能,借助一些支持的工具或钱包,可以为未确认的交易提高手续费,这能够吸引矿工优先处理这笔交易。不过,要谨慎使用此功能,以免造成不必要的费用支出。
另外,根据区块链的特点,一些钱包允许用户取消未确认的交易。然而,并不像所有链都如此便捷,有的时候需谨慎处理,以免对后续的交易产生影响。
区块链运行出现问题的表现形式有很多,可能是网络延迟、交易确认时间过长、节点失联等。这类问题的出现通常与多种因素有关,如洪峰式交易量、系统bug、黑客攻击等。
通过监控社区动态与各大媒体,用户可以有更好的判断。例如,此前某些交易所因网络异常而频繁出现不到账的交易,这往往需要及时关注并与支持团队联系,保证信息的正常流通。
此外,区块链网络聚合了各种元素,进行检查和复查也是非常必要的,例如通过第三方监控情报网站,获取更为全面的数据和信息,判断问题发生背景及应对措施。
监控特定区块链的健康状态可以从多个维度入手,如区块生成速度、交易量、网络延迟等。使用一些专门的监控工具,如 Grafana 或 Prometheus,可以定制化地呈现各种监控指标。
此外,可以关注媒体报道和社群讨论,及时捕捉某些突发问题的信息。例如,通过 Telegram、Discord 等平台的信息交流,能够迅速得知网络的最新动态和健康状况。
选择适合的监控工具和平台再加上专业的分析能力,也能够帮助用户更好地判断区块链的正常性,并针对问题寻求解决方案。
当用户发现区块链存在问题,例如交易长时间未确认或网络异常,应首先记录详细信息并进行初步分析。可以收集交易哈希、发送时间、预设费用、相关区块信息等,作为反馈的依据。
之后,应及时联系相关区块链项目的客服或社区管理,提供具体的交易详情,协助技术团队进行排查。例如,很多公司社区都设有 Telegram 群组,在上面可以直接咨询,通常能获得快速反馈。保持与官方渠道的沟通,也有可能得到多方位的信息帮助。
同时,用户还可以关注第三方监测平台,获悉其他用户的问题与建议,通过社区的共同力量来解决问题。了解网络的健康运营是每位区块链用户应尽的责任。
综上,对区块链信息正常性的关注是一个多方面的课题,既需要技术手段的支持,也离不开社群的互动与沟通。通过有效的监控工具、分析机制以及社区力量,用户和开发者能够更好地确保区块链网络的健康运转。